Glutathione ( GSH ) - The Master Antioxidant

Foods and dietary supplements that help boost glutathione levels naturally

1. N-Acetyl-Cysteine (NAC) It is derived from the amino acid L-Cysteine, and acts as a precursor of glutathione. NAC is quickly metabolized into glutathione once it enters the body. It has been proven in numerous scientific studies and clinical trials, to boost intracellular production of glutathione.

2. Milk Thistle (silymarin) is a powerful antioxidant and supports the liver by preventing the depletion of glutathione. Silymarin is the active compound of milk thistle. It is a natural liver detoxifier and protects the liver from many toxins such as carbon tetrachloride and alcohol.

3. Alpha Lipoic Acid
is made naturally in cells as a by-product of energy release, ALA increases the levels of intra-cellular glutathione, and is a natural antioxidant and free radical scavenger. It has the ability to regenerate oxidized antioxidants like Vitamin C and E and helps to make them more potent. ALA is also known for its ability to enhance glucose uptake and may help prevent the cellular damage accompanying the complications of diabetes. It also has a protective effect in the brain.

5. Raw egg contain beta-lactoglobulin and serum albumin. They are proteins that contain a bond of two glutathione precursors: glutamyl ( a form of glutamic acid ) and cysteine. This bond is called glutamyl-cysteine, which is 2/3 of a glutathione molecule The other 1/3 is glycine ). The egg white has to be raw and not scrambled or mixed, because heating, cooking or mixing will destroy these delicate proteins.

6. Un-denatured ( unheated ) whey protein also have beta-lactoglobulin and serum albumin, two glutathione precursors. Heating or pasteurization destroys the delicate disulphide bonds that give these proteins their bioactivity.

7. Curcumin (Turmeric) has been found to increase expression of the glutathione S-transferase and protect neurons exposed to oxidant stress.
Curcumin alters EpRE and AP-1 binding complexes and elevates glutamate-cysteine ligase gene expression.

8. Balloon Flower Root (Jie Geng) have been found to increase intracellular glutathione (GSH) content and significantly reduce oxidative injury to liver cells, minimise cell death and lipid peroxidation.

9. Selenium
is a co-factor for the enzyme glutathione peroxidase. One Brazil nut per day contain daily need of selenium.

10. Homocysteine blockers  SAM-e, TMG, B2, B6, folate and B12 are also glutathione precursors.

Glutathione (GSH) plays a key role in protecting mitochondria and mtDNA from oxidative damage. GSH protects against mtDNA-damaging lipid peroxidation in the inner mitochondrial membrane, where the ETC [Electron Transport Chain] is located. GSH (glutathione) also breaks down hydrogen peroxide (H2O2), another oxidant normally produced within mitochondria and which damages mtDNA.

Unfortunately, "Glutathione oxidation increases with age in mitochondria from liver, kidney, and brain of rats. It is striking that this increase was much higher in mitochondria than in whole cells." And mitochondria are at special risk with regard to GSH, because they lack the ability to synthesize GSH or to rid themselves of oxidized glutathione (GSS).

Sastre and colleagues found that GSSG levels doubled in old rats compared to young rats, while GSH levels dropped 40% and hydrogen peroxide generation increased 22%." - from The Mitochondrial Theory of Aging (James South).

"The role of GSH [Glutathione] as a reductant is extremely important particularly in the highly oxidizing environment of the erythrocyte [red blood cell]. The sulfhydryl of GSH can be used to reduce peroxides formed during oxygen transport." - from Tyrosine-derived neurotransmitters.. Examine Glutathione supplements.
